Common HeatShield Chimney Cleaning Problems We Solve in Teaneck

  • Acidic condensate dissolving mortar between oversized clay tiles. Teaneck’s 8×13-inch oil-era flues vent modern gas appliances with exhaust that’s cooler and more acidic than the original design allowed. That condensate eats the mortar joints between tile sections for years, creating hidden carbon monoxide bypass channels behind walls. Our Level 2 camera catches this before it becomes a headline.
  • Freeze-thaw spalling in unlined brick flues from 1920s–1950s construction. Bergen County’s cold, wet winters hit harder in Teaneck’s low-lying position near the Hackensack River valley. Persistent moisture penetrates aged lime mortar, freezes, expands, and pops off brick faces — voids that standard sweeping can’t reach and that compromise any liner installation until rebuilt.
  • Layered creosote and tar blocking HeatShield foam adhesion. Oil-to-gas conversions left behind petroleum deposits that standard brushes won’t touch. We chemically pre-treat these flues before applying any HeatShield product — otherwise the foam bonds to tar, not tile, and fails within seasons.
  • Multi-flue chimneys serving incompatible appliances. Many Teaneck colonials have one flue for a fireplace and another repurposed from oil boiler to gas furnace. The fireplace flue may sweep clean while the mechanical flue rots unseen — our inspection protocol checks every passage, not just the obvious one.
  • Crown and cap failure accelerating liner damage. Teaneck’s spring freeze-thaw cycles crack concrete crowns and rust cheap caps, funneling water directly onto new HeatShield linings. We pair every relining with proper crown assessment and install Gelco or Famco multi-flue caps where needed — professional-grade materials, properly installed.

HeatShield Service in Teaneck: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Teaneck’s 07666 ZIP code has the highest concentration of 8×13-inch clay flues originally built for oil-fired boilers found anywhere in Bergen County — a direct result of the town’s mid-century streetcar-suburb expansion where over 60% of homes were built between 1920 and 1950 and later converted to gas without upsizing the flue. This isn’t a footnote for chimney trivia; it’s the single factor that determines whether your HeatShield job lasts twenty years or fails in two.

Here’s what that means practically. A 100,000 BTU gas boiler pushing exhaust up a flue designed for a 250,000 BTU oil burner moves gas too slowly. The exhaust cools before it exits, condensing into sulfuric acid that pools in the flue base and weeps through cracked mortar. We’ve scoped Teaneck chimneys where the tile looked intact from the top but the camera revealed mortar reduced to sand between sections — a carbon monoxide pathway the homeowner had lived with for fifteen years. HeatShield Cerfractory Foam was developed specifically for this scenario: it fills those voids, restores proper flue dimensions, and creates a continuous acid-resistant surface. But it only works if the pre-inspection is honest and the prep work is thorough. In Teaneck, shortcuts kill.

HeatShield Models & Products We Service in Teaneck

We work with three HeatShield product lines, applied based on what your flue actually needs — not what pads the invoice.

HeatShield Cerfractory Foam — Our go-to for structurally sound flues with intact tiles but failed mortar joints or minor spalling. Applied with a custom-forming plug, it creates a seamless, code-compliant liner rated to 3,000°F. We stock this for Teaneck jobs with typical 2–3 day turnaround from inspection to completion.

HeatShield Stainless Steel Relining Kits — When tile loss exceeds 50% or the flue has major structural compromise, foam won’t save it. We specify Olympia Chimney or DuraFlex stainless liners for these cases — full tear-out and reline, not a band-aid. Paul Torres handles the measuring and fitting personally; no “close enough” on liner diameter.

HeatShield Crown Coat — Flexible waterproof membrane for cracked crowns, often paired with foam relining to stop the water intrusion that would otherwise undermine the new liner. We apply this with proper cure-time scheduling — not in forecast rain, not in freezing temps.

HeatShield Service Pricing in Teaneck

Here’s what HeatShield work costs in the Teaneck market, based on jobs we’ve completed across the 07666 ZIP code:

  • Level 2 Camera Inspection: $250–$400 (required before any relining decision; includes written report and video)
  • HeatShield Cerfractory Foam Relining: $2,500–$5,000 (typical single-flue colonial; varies with flue height, access, and pre-treatment needs)
  • HeatShield Stainless Steel Relining Kit: $4,500–$8,500 (full liner replacement; includes removal of failed tiles where accessible)
  • Chemical Pre-Treatment (oil/coal tar deposits): $400–$800 (added when conversion residue blocks foam adhesion)
  • Crown Repair with HeatShield Crown Coat: $800–$1,800 (varies with crown size and rebuild requirements)
  • Multi-Flue Cap Installation (Gelco/Famco): $600–$1,400 (per flue; stainless or copper options)

What drives cost: flue height (Teaneck’s two-story colonials average 25–35 feet), degree of tile damage, accessibility (steep roof pitch, chimney location), and whether chemical pre-treatment is needed for conversion residue.
